Introduction to Affordable Cloud-Based CRM

A Customer Relationship Management (CRM) system is a technology that helps businesses manage interactions and relationships with current and potential customers. It allows companies to organize, automate, and synchronize sales, marketing, customer service, and support activities.

Cloud-based technology in CRM systems refers to the software being hosted on remote servers accessed through the internet. This allows for easy access, scalability, and cost-effectiveness compared to traditional on-premise solutions.

Affordability is crucial in CRM solutions as it enables small and medium-sized businesses to access the benefits of CRM without breaking the bank. This makes it easier for companies to adopt and implement CRM systems to improve customer relationships and drive sales.

Advantages and Disadvantages of Cloud-Based CRM

Advantages:

  • Cost-effective solution with lower upfront costs
  • Scalability to accommodate business growth
  • Automatic software updates for improved functionality

Disadvantages:

  • Dependence on internet connectivity for access
  • Potential security concerns with data stored offsite
  • Limited customization options compared to on-premise solutions

Cost Benefits of Choosing Cloud-Based CRM

Cost Aspect Cloud-Based CRM Traditional CRM Software
Initial Setup Lower upfront costs Higher upfront costs for hardware and software
Maintenance Automatic updates included Additional costs for updates and maintenance
Scalability Easy scalability based on business needs Limited scalability, may require hardware upgrades

Security Measures in Affordable Cloud-Based CRM

When it comes to affordable cloud-based CRM systems, ensuring the security of customer data is paramount. Let’s delve into the security features and measures that protect data in these CRM solutions.

Data Encryption and Protection

  • Encryption techniques such as SSL/TLS are applied to secure data transmission between the user’s device and the cloud server. This ensures that sensitive information remains encrypted and protected from unauthorized access.
  • Data at rest is also encrypted to safeguard it from potential breaches or theft. This additional layer of security ensures that even if data is compromised, it remains unreadable without the decryption key.

Access Controls and User Permissions

  • Robust access controls and user permissions play a crucial role in maintaining the security of customer data. By assigning specific access levels to users based on their roles, organizations can limit who can view, edit, or delete sensitive information.
  • Implementing multi-factor authentication adds an extra layer of security by requiring users to provide multiple forms of verification before accessing the CRM system.

Regular Security Audits and Updates

  • Regular security audits and updates are essential in ensuring the integrity of data in cloud-based CRM systems. By conducting routine security checks, organizations can identify and address vulnerabilities before they are exploited by malicious actors.
  • Timely software updates help in patching known security flaws and vulnerabilities, thereby reducing the risk of data breaches and ensuring that the CRM system remains secure and up-to-date.

Compliance Standards

  • Cloud-based CRM systems must adhere to industry-specific compliance standards such as GDPR, HIPAA, or PCI DSS to enhance data protection and privacy. Compliance with these regulations ensures that customer data is handled in a secure and transparent manner.
  • By meeting these compliance standards, organizations can demonstrate their commitment to data security and build trust with customers who entrust them with their sensitive information.

Comparison with On-Premise CRM Systems

When comparing the scalability of cloud-based CRM solutions to traditional on-premise systems, the cloud-based option offers more flexibility and agility. On-premise systems often require significant investments in infrastructure and IT resources to scale, whereas cloud-based CRM solutions can easily adapt to changing business needs without the same level of complexity.
